FEAG is a medium-sized industrial company, a special company for switchgear construction and part of the FEAG Group. At the St. Ingbert site, about 160 employees work on tailor-made solutions for energy supply, industrial automation and modern switching systems. What you do professionally You construct safety-critical switching systems in the future energy transition market and ensure that technical decisions are standard-proof, manufacturing-friendly and economically viable. You'll start current schedules, production documents and parts lists in EPLAN. You design and realize switching systems according to IEC/VDE standards and network operator TAB. You clarify technical questions with customers, suppliers, manufacturing and project environment. You drive technical work packages independently and actively demand missing documents. You support heat balances, short-circuit and network calculations as complementary engineering tasks. You prepare type checks before and after or accompany complex decreases as required.
